Neo banks are pure digital banking banks utilizing advanced technologies and AI to extend frictionless financial services without having actual branches. In this study, user adoption, use and recommendation of neo banks were assessed using the UTAUT III framework, putting strong emphasis on user interface design that is focused on the users. A relational and descriptive research design was used with data gathering from 276 respondents who know about Neo Banking through proper tests of reliability and validity. Therefore, purposive sampling technique was employed. PLS-SEM through WRAP PLS was used in the study to examine major adoption factors, and it was found that performance expectancy (PE) and personal innovativeness (PI) have a significant impact on adoption intention. The results provide actionable recommendations for app developers to improve user experience through intuitive design, AI-based personalization, and accessibility features. Banks can enhance adoption by adopting trust-building strategies such as transparent security protocols and targeted awareness campaigns. By integrating interface design with UTAUT principles, neo banks can achieve long-term engagement and customer loyalty. These findings help to maximize digital banking platforms toward a more inclusive and seamless financial ecosystem.
